Went in Wed morning to GBMC in Towson. Took a nap in the OR and woke up in recovery. Pain like a bad stomach ache. 4 holes and a JP drain. Hospital was great. Cute nurses. Walk and sip, Walk and sip. Had trouble sleeping Went home Fri afternoon. Pretty miserable Fri thru Sat morning. Gas Gas Gas. Walk drink walk.

Yea Gas -X strips and Prevacid. Felt good Saturday night, slept well, started full liquids today. So far, OK

I am doing well. Stopped the drugs Friday night. Getting up and down can be painful. ie. chair to standing, getting out of bed, etc., but it's better every day.About once aday I grind up two tylenol and wash them down with crystal lite.Energy is good, but I think it will be a week before I am back to normal. Little shakey sometimes.

Not really hungry but the chobolate muscle milk lite was a treat. The smell of the chicken and meatloaf being cooked in the kitchen didn't really bother me.

I see the doctor Fri and hope to graduate to soft food then.
